Real-World Testing: Putting 557 Velcro Surgical Glove Pouch to the Test

First Use Experience

My first opportunity to test the 557 Velcro Surgical Glove Pouch came during a wilderness first aid training course. I integrated it into my existing trauma kit, which I carried during simulated scenarios. The pouch was easily accessible when responding to a “victim” with a mock laceration.

The conditions were dry, but the real test came during a scenario involving simulated rain. Despite some dampness, the Velcro closure remained secure, and the gloves inside stayed relatively dry. The ease of opening the pouch with one hand was a definite plus during the simulation.

There were no significant issues during the initial use, but the leather felt a bit stiff, requiring a firm pull to open the Velcro. I anticipated this would improve with break-in.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several months of carrying the 557 Velcro Surgical Glove Pouch in my duty bag, I have a better understanding of its long-term reliability. The leather has softened slightly, making the Velcro easier to open and close while still remaining secure. There are minimal signs of wear and tear, a testament to the quality of the Aker Leather.

Cleaning is simple; a wipe with a damp cloth keeps the leather looking good. I’ve noticed that periodically re-seating the gloves within the pouch keeps them organized and prevents bunching when removing them quickly. Compared to keeping gloves loose in my bag, the 557 Velcro Surgical Glove Pouch is far superior in terms of protection and accessibility.

Breaking Down the Features of 557 Velcro Surgical Glove Pouch

Specifications

  • The 557 Velcro Surgical Glove Pouch is designed to hold up to four surgical gloves. This provides adequate capacity for most immediate medical needs.
  • It features a secure hoop and loop fastener (Velcro) closure. This ensures the gloves remain safely inside until needed.
  • The pouch is constructed from genuine leather. This provides durability and a professional appearance.
  • The pouch easily slides onto a duty belt or can be stowed in a bag. This provides versatility in carry options.
  • The price is $30.49. It offers a reasonably affordable solution for glove storage.

These specifications are important because they balance portability, durability, and accessibility. The leather construction ensures the pouch can withstand daily use, while the capacity and Velcro closure address the primary need for readily available surgical gloves.
